Jaroslaw Nabrzyski

Jaroslaw (Jarek) Nabrzyski, executive director of the Louisiana State University Center for Computation and Technology, has been named director of the University of Notre Dame’s Center for Research Computing (CRC). He will assume his new position May 1.

The center, a joint effort of Notre Dame’s Offices of Information Technologies (OIT) and Research and its colleges, supports the research agenda of the University through high availability of managed computing assets and staff with expertise in the application of these resources to multi-disciplinary research interests.

As director, Nabrzyski will lead the preparation, promotion and execution of a visionary roadmap for the growth, evolution and utilization of computational technologies in support of advancing research initiatives from all of Notre Dame’s colleges. He also will play a central role in shaping the University’s participation in the Northwest Indiana Computational Grid Initiative, a federally-supported, multi-million dollar effort to establish a world-class grid computing environment that involves Purdue University (West Lafayette and Calumet campuses), Argonne National Laboratory and Notre Dame.

Nabrzyski’s research interests have been focused on multi-objective project scheduling and resources management techniques for parallel and distributed computing. He has been working on tools and middleware technologies for computational grids and distributed systems. His primary goal is to develop tools and technologies to enhance cyberinfrastructure.

As executive director of the Louisiana State University Center for Computation and Technology, Nabrzyski was responsible for overseeing its cyberinfrastructure research and development, HPC operations and support, economic development and research enablement.

Prior to accepting his position at Louisiana State last year, he was the Applications Department manager at the Poznan Supercomputing and Networking Center.

Nabrzyski earned a diploma, master of science and doctoral degrees in computer science from the Poznan University of Technology.
